ListN Up
ListN Up is a series of weekly artist-curated playlists. Born from a desire to keep artists sharing and connected during times of isolation, ListN Up offers an intimate sonic portrait of contemporary artists by showcasing the diverse and stylistically varied music that influences their creative practice. Navigating Unemployment Insurance Study Hall
Navigating Unemployment Insurance Study Hall
Hosted by Springboard for the Arts The CARES Act expands eligibility for unemployment compensation to self-employed individuals, independent contractors, “gig economy” employees, and individuals who were unable to start a new job or contract due to the pandemic.
